Flash Flood Warning
National Weather Service Columbia SC
656 PM EDT Thu Apr 24 2025

The National Weather Service in Columbia has issued a

* Flash Flood Warning for...
  West Central Bamberg County in central South Carolina...
  Southeastern Barnwell County in central South Carolina...

* Until 1000 PM EDT.

* At 656 PM EDT, Doppler radar and automated rain gauges indicated
  thunderstorms producing heavy rain across the warned area. Flash
  flooding is ongoing or expected to begin shortly.

  HAZARD...Flash flooding caused by thunderstorms.

  SOURCE...Radar and automated gauges show that over 3 inches of
           rainfall has fallen over the area.  Additional
           rainfall amounts of up to 2 inches are possible.

  IMPACT...Flash flooding of small creeks and streams, urban
           areas, highways, streets and underpasses as well as
           other poor drainage and low-lying areas.

* Some locations that will experience flash flooding include...
  Barnwell, Blackville, Barnwell State Park, Hilda, Snelling and
  Barnwell County Airport.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

Most flooding deaths occur in vehicles. Never drive through a
flooded roadway or around barricades. Turn around, don`t drown.
